BUILDING USE PROTOCOL *UPDATED August 13, 2020
For the foreseeable future, the building will continue to remain closed to most activities. We do not have an exact date as to when this will change because there are many unpredictable factors that will effect the decision. What we do know for certain is that we will not be hosting large gatherings such as Sunday Services until we determine that it is safe to do so.
(See the Rental Policy - UNTIL FURTHER NOTICE below for more details on building use.)
Individuals who need to do repairs or routine maintenance must contact the church office to get the door code. The primary individuals entering the building at this time are core staff and the custodians.
SUMMARY
- We are tracking everyone who is in the building
- Contact the church office to request the new door code
- Please follow the SIMPLE GUIDELINES
- Do not leave any garbage that cannot be recycled (food stuffs mainly.)
- Please wipe down surfaces that you have touched before you leave the building (e.g. doorknobs, countertops, keyboards, phones, copier) using a provided Clorox wipe. If Clorox wipes are not available, please use hand sanitizer on a provided paper towel.
The following policy statements were affirmed by the Board of Trustees at their August 2020 meeting. Please let our minister Oscar Sinclair or our board president, Trevor Jones, know if you have any questions.
Until we can ensure the safety of building users we will not be allowing outside rentals to use the building. When circumstances change we will communicate through multiple channels. We are relying on information from multiple sources to inform our decision-making including the CDC, WHO, UUA and the Lincoln/Lancaster County Health Department.
RITES OF PASSAGE EXCEPTION
At the Minister’s discretion, rites of passage (Memorials, Celebrations of Life or Weddings) may be scheduled inside or outside of the building with these expectations:
- Ten people maximum in attendance including the minister
- Six foot social distancing with those who do not live in your household
- Masks worn by all unless the person is using the microphone
At the Minister’s discretion, events in the parking lot may be scheduled with these expectations:
- Events are geared towards “drive-thru” or “sign-up-for-time-slots” types of events in order to limit the number of people who are interacting with each other at any given time
- Ten people maximum in attendance/interacting at any one time
- Six foot social distancing with those who do not live in your household
- Masks worn by all
We are allowing one exception to the Fall 2020 Rental Policy for Bluestem Montessori School. This exception is being allowed for multiple reasons:
- We have a long-term relationship with Bluestem
- Bluestem has their own liability insurance
- Bluestem uses one specific contained area of the church (Religious Growth and Learning (RGL) wing)
- The RGL wing has its own adult and child size restrooms
- The RGL wing has its own kitchenette and prep area
- The Unitarian Church of Lincoln is not currently holding Sunday Services or Sunday School
- We are able to limit the exposure between Bluestem staff/students and other users of the building
- Only Bluestem teachers are allowed to enter parts of the building other than the RGL wing (e.g. church office and kitchen) with the exception of the students making their way through the building from the RGL wing to the north playground
- Bluestem plans to teach remotely while the Lancaster County Covid dial is in orange or red. They plan to teach onsite if the dial is in yellow or green.

SCAMS VIA EMAIL
The frequency of scam emails has increased since March 2020. Every other week or so we get a flurry of emails from members and friends who are wondering if they are really from our minister Oscar Sinclair.
Here are further clues you know the answer to that question:
1. The emails come from a bogus email address.... Oscar's REAL email is minister@unitarianlincoln.org
2. The emails use language that doesn't sound like the way that Oscar speaks such as "Blessings"
3. Oscar will NEVER ask you for money in this manner. He will never solicit money for himself, the church, or another congregant via email, text or private message.
